Imaging Mode 1 | Polarization | Resolution (m) | Swath (Km) | Num of Synthetic Aperture Radar Scenes Used |
---|---|---|---|---|
SS | VV + VH or HH + HV | 25 | 130 | 26 |
QPSI | VV + HH + VH + HV | 8 | 30 | 3 |
QPSII | VV + HH + VH + HV | 25 | 40 | 5 |
FSI | HH + HV | 5 | 50 | 2 |
NSC | VV + VH | 50 | 300 | 1 |

Polarization of GF-3 Data | Wind Speed | Wind Direction | GMF Used | ||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
N | Bias (m/s) | RMSE (m/s) | N | Bias (°) | RMSE (°) | ||
All co-polarization | 56 | 0.66 | 2.46 | 45 | 1.35 | 22.22 | VV: CMOD5.n HH:CMOD5.n + PR model from Zhang et al. [10] |
VV | 14 | −0.15 | 2.34 | 14 | 4.85 | 21.91 | |
HH | 42 | 0.93 | 2.50 | 31 | −0.23 | 22.37 |
